Sunday Sermon: Do not Stumble at your Miracle, July 5, 2020



We are confronted daily with forces we do not understand, hence, we should not allow ourselves to be flattered by Satan to lean on our own strength, pomp, or self-pride. To know what we cannot do for ourselves in challenging times is spiritual insight and to seek help from Gods in wisdom. Self-pride only reflects our lack of understanding and insensitivity to the challenges we face. Someone in crisis needs a savior and God is always there to help if we will ask Him.


Luke 4:27: (Additional reading 2 Kings 5:1-17)

27 And many lepers were in Israel in the time of Eliseus the prophet; and none of them was cleansed, saving Naaman the Syrian.


Jesus pressed the audience to realized that: (a) Salvation is not by might, (2) the Christian faith is to know Christ, and (3), Our faith can change the world


Salvation is not power or might


  1. It is free and righteousness is by faith

    1. 1 Peter 1:18-19 … ye were not redeemed with corruptible things, as silver and gold, … But with the precious blood of Christ, as of a lamb without blemish and without spot:

    2. Acts 4:12- Neither is there salvation in any other: for there is none other name under heaven given among men, whereby we must be saved

  2. Faith is built on the word of God and not on spiritual exercises. Naaman’s knowledge of God was helped not only by the healing, but by the spoken word of the Lord through the prophet.

Heb 11:6 - But without faith it is impossible to please him …


The Christian faith is to know God


Naaman’s struggles in the process came from intellectual and national pride.


  1. Intellectually: The act of remission of his leprosy required submission on his own part as opposed to the miraculous act of laying hand of the preacher.

Nationally: Abana and Pharpar rivers might be cleaner rivers, but they were not the issues rather his obedience to God’s word was the issue.

  1. Naaman was flattered by his ego, thinking that God will play ball on his own terms. Go WASH AND BE CLEAN, was so simple than he imagined that he stumbled over it and could not see it.

    1. In the text, leprosy represents sin, which there is no medical cure. It can only be remitted through immersion baptism

    2. His multi Million dollars gift were not enough, neither the personal audience of the preacher that he sought.


Our faith can change the world


  1. Our God is incomprehensible. He uses ordinary people like the slave girl, and Naaman’s servant as guiding lights in the darkest moments.

    1. John 1:4-5 - In him was life; and the life was the light of men. 5 And the light shineth in darkness; and the darkness comprehended it not.

    2. Dan 11:32- … but the people that do know their God shall be strong and do exploits.

  2. And they that understand among the people shall instruct many: …

  3. Be cognizant that the truth comes something from less visible people. So, do not hang your faith on big name preachers or big churches.

    1. Sin is like an incurable leprosy that money or recognition cannot cure. It can only be washed away by immersion baptism in name of Jesus Act 2:38,39

    2. Like Naaman, dip yourself in: (1) acknowledging your sins, (2) repenting from it, (3) confessing your faith in baptism, (4) justifying your faith for the forgiveness of sin, (5) reconciling with God through the baptism of the Holy Spirit, (6) sanctifying yourself by His word unto holiness, and (7) redeeming yourself unto eternity with Christ


Your salvation is the miracle in front of you today, do not stumble at it because it is free.
